Christophe Leroy e59596a2d6 powerpc: Use static call for get_irq()
__do_irq() inconditionnaly calls ppc_md.get_irq()

That's definitely a hot path.

At the time being ppc_md.get_irq address is read every time
from ppc_md structure.

Replace that call by a static call, and initialise that
call after ppc_md.init_IRQ() has set ppc_md.get_irq.

Emit a warning and don't set the static call if ppc_md.init_IRQ()
is still NULL, that way the kernel won't blow up if for some
reason ppc_md.get_irq() doesn't get properly set.

With the patch:

	00000000 <__SCT__ppc_get_irq>:
	   0:	48 00 00 20 	b       20 <__static_call_return0>	<== Replaced by 'b <ppc_md.get_irq>' at runtime
...
	00000020 <__static_call_return0>:
	  20:	38 60 00 00 	li      r3,0
	  24:	4e 80 00 20 	blr
...
	00000058 <__do_irq>:
...
	  64:	48 00 00 01 	bl      64 <__do_irq+0xc>
				64: R_PPC_REL24	__SCT__ppc_get_irq
	  68:	2c 03 00 00 	cmpwi   r3,0
...

Before the patch:

	00000038 <__do_irq>:
...
	  3c:	3d 20 00 00 	lis     r9,0
				3e: R_PPC_ADDR16_HA	ppc_md+0x1c
...
	  44:	81 29 00 00 	lwz     r9,0(r9)
				46: R_PPC_ADDR16_LO	ppc_md+0x1c
...
	  4c:	7d 29 03 a6 	mtctr   r9
	  50:	4e 80 04 21 	bctrl
	  54:	2c 03 00 00 	cmpwi   r3,0
...

On PPC64 which doesn't implement static calls yet we get:

00000000000000d0 <__do_irq>:
...
      dc:	00 00 22 3d 	addis   r9,r2,0
			dc: R_PPC64_TOC16_HA	.data+0x8
...
      e4:	00 00 89 e9 	ld      r12,0(r9)
			e4: R_PPC64_TOC16_LO_DS	.data+0x8
...
      f0:	a6 03 89 7d 	mtctr   r12
      f4:	18 00 41 f8 	std     r2,24(r1)
      f8:	21 04 80 4e 	bctrl
      fc:	18 00 41 e8 	ld      r2,24(r1)
...

So on PPC64 that's similar to what we get without static calls.
But at least until ppc_md.get_irq() is set the call is to
__static_call_return0.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
